Boston Children’s Chorus (BCC) presents its 18th Annual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. Tribute Concert: “Born on the Water.”
"They say our people were born on the water. They were made black by those who believed themselves to be white." -Nikole Hannah-Jones from the podcast 1619
Boston Children’s Chorus unites its voices to honor the resilience of a people that have formed the backbone of this country’s cultural heritage. In 1619, the first slave-bearing ship, the White Lion, arrived on the shores of North America, marking the onset of centuries-long injustice borne by black Americans. Drawing upon a rich artistic legacy, we share music that underscores the history of the African American experience and reflect on the teachings of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r.
